With HSBC and the Yorkshire Building Society both announcing branch closures, what effect will it have on rural communities? Should Saturday night television face stricter advertising rules to stop children who are staying up late from seeing adverts for fast food and sugary drinks? A European Court again rules that compensation should be paid to women who were given faulty breast implants. Yet some still feel they are no closer to receiving a payment. How easy is it to get life insurance if you have a history of mental illness? And how to make the best out of granny's hand-me-down jewellery. Presenter: Winifred Robinson Producer: Pete Wilson.
